如何使用Java將查詢到的數(shù)據(jù)轉(zhuǎn)換為Excel文件
在Java中,我們可以使用JXL包來將查詢到的數(shù)據(jù)轉(zhuǎn)換為Excel文件。下面是一個簡單的步驟: 步驟1:導(dǎo)入JXL包 首先,我們需要導(dǎo)入JXL包,以便在Java代碼中使用相關(guān)的類和方法。 步驟2
在Java中,我們可以使用JXL包來將查詢到的數(shù)據(jù)轉(zhuǎn)換為Excel文件。下面是一個簡單的步驟:
步驟1:導(dǎo)入JXL包
首先,我們需要導(dǎo)入JXL包,以便在Java代碼中使用相關(guān)的類和方法。
步驟2:從數(shù)據(jù)庫中查詢數(shù)據(jù)
在生成Excel文件之前,我們需要手動編寫查詢語句,從ORACLE數(shù)據(jù)庫中獲取數(shù)據(jù)。然后,通過操作將數(shù)據(jù)寫入Excel文件。
步驟3:從Excel文件中讀取數(shù)據(jù)
如果需要將數(shù)據(jù)讀取到ORACLE數(shù)據(jù)庫中,我們同樣需要先讀取Excel工作薄中的內(nèi)容,然后通過INSERT語句將其插入到數(shù)據(jù)庫中。
示例代碼:
import jxl.*;
import jxl.write.*;
import *;
public class ExcelHandle {
public ExcelHandle() {}
// 讀取Excel文件
public static void readExcel(String filePath) {
try {
InputStream is new FileInputStream(filePath);
Workbook rwb (is);
Sheet st ("original");//這里有兩種方法獲取sheet表,1為名字,而為下標,從0開始
Cell c00 (0,0);
String strc00 ();
if(() CellType.L